WebJul 6, 2024 · Can a pellet stove use the same chimney as a wood stove? Each chimney flue may only service one solid fuel-burning appliance. No combination of fuel-gas, oil-fired, or additional wood, wood pellet, coal or corn stoves may be vented into the same chimney flue as a solid fuel-burning appliance.
